Commander Michael “Chowder” Moorse

Commander Michael Moorse, a native of Hurst, Texas, graduated from the U.S. Naval Academy in 2006 with his commission and Bachelor of Science degree in Systems Engineering.  He was designated a Naval Aviator in 2008 and reported to the HSL-40 “Airwolves” in Mayport, Florida for initial fleet training in the SH-60B Seahawk.

CDR Moorse was assigned to his first operational tour in 2009 with the “Vipers” of HSL-48 in Mayport, Florida.  There he completed deployments on USS ELROD (FFG 55) in support of FIFTH Fleet counter-piracy operations and USS NITZE (DDG 94) in support of FOURTH Fleet operations.  Ashore, he served as Detachment Maintenance Officer and squadron Naval Air Training and Operating Procedures Standardization (NATOPS) Officer.

In 2012, CDR Moorse reported to the “Seahawks” of HSM-41 in San Diego, California where he transitioned to the MH-60R helicopter and served as a Fleet Replacement Squadron Instructor Pilot.  He also held positions as Search and Rescue Officer and NATOPS Officer.  He also earned an Executive Master of Business Administration degree from the U.S. Naval Postgraduate School while assigned to HSM-41.

CDR Moorse then reported to USS ANCHORAGE (LPD 23) in 2015 and served as Assistant Air Officer and Aviation Fuels Officer on the maiden deployment to the FIFTH and SEVENTH Fleet areas of operation with the ESSEX Amphibious Ready Group and 15th Marine Expeditionary Unit.  Upon return to homeport in San Diego, he assumed duties as Air Officer and Afloat Safety Officer and led the ship through aviation certification preparations during an extensive shipyard repair availability period. 

In 2017, CDR Moorse returned to flying duty as a Department Head with the HSM-72 “Proud Warriors” in Jacksonville, Florida.  He completed deployments to SIXTH Fleet on USS BULKELEY (DDG 84) as Combat Element TWO Officer-in-Charge and on                             USS HARRY S. TRUMAN (CVN 75) as the squadron Operations Officer in support of Operation INHERENT RESOLVE and the first-ever Dynamic Force Employment.

In 2020, CDR Moorse attended the U.S. Naval War College in Newport, Rhode Island, where he graduated with highest distinction and earned a Master of Arts degree in Defense and Strategic Studies.  He then reported to the Joint Chiefs of Staff at the Pentagon in Washington, DC and served as action officer and Mission Assurance Branch Chief in the Deputy Directorate for Nuclear and Homeland Defense Operations, J-36.  He reported to the “Easyriders” of HSM-37 in April 2023 to assume duties as Executive Officer.

CDR Moorse has accumulated over 2,200 flight hours in naval aircraft.  His awards include the Defense Meritorious Service Medal, the Navy and Marine Corps Commendation Medal (two awards), the Navy and Marine Corps Achievement Medal (three awards), and various unit and campaign awards.
